Output 4f62b815234368e588d9f8b717afacc985a7f5d66dde76fafbaab5e51eae36c5:0

value
875511
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68fdab0077a18c5068ef6dfc545b7a44e62c990f OP_EQUAL
address
3BGA5etYqxwUu7wHTk8cJx7m2wLxbZLe23
transaction
4f62b815234368e588d9f8b717afacc985a7f5d66dde76fafbaab5e51eae36c5
spent
true